> Thank you very much for replys.
> 
> But I think it seems not to relate with stale data problem in compcache.
> My question was why last chance to allocate memory was failed.
> When OOM killer is executed, memory state is not a condition to
> execute OOM killer.
> Specially, there are so many pages of order 0. And allocating order is zero.
> I think that last allocating memory should have succeeded.
> That's my worry.

Yes. I agree with you.
Mel. Could you give some comment in this situation ?
Is it possible that order 0 allocation is failed 
even there are many pages in buddy ?

> 
> -----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
>       page = get_page_from_freelist(gfp_mask|__GFP_HARDWALL, order,
> <== this is last chance
>                            zonelist, ALLOC_WMARK_HIGH|ALLOC_CPUSET);
> <== uses ALLOC_WMARK_HIGH
>       if (page)
>       goto got_pg;
> 
>       out_of_memory(zonelist, gfp_mask, order);
>       goto restart;
> -----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
